1. Streaming Services: One of the most significant trends in cross-platform entertainment is the increasing popularity of streaming services. Platforms like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ime Video have revolutionized the way we consume content, offering a vast library of movies and TV shows that can be accessed anytime, anywhere. These services are not only changing how content is delivered but also how it is created, with many producers and directors now opting to release their projects directly to streaming platforms.
2. Mobile Gaming: Another key trend in cross-platform entertainment is the growing popularity of mobile gaming. With the rise of smartphones and tablets, more people than ever are playing games on the go. Mobile games are not only entertaining but also highly profitable, with many developers earning substantial revenues from in-app purchases and advertising. The merging of mobile and traditional gaming platforms is creating new opportunities for cross-platform experiences, allowing players to seamlessly transition between devices.
3. Virtual Reality and Augmented Reality: Vir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are also transforming click here the entertainment industry, offering immersive experiences that blur the lines between the digital and physical worlds. From virtual concerts to interactive museum exhibits, VR and AR technologies are revolutionizing how we engage with entertainment content. These technologies are not only enhancing the viewer experience but also providing new avenues for monetization through virtual events and branded content.
4. Social Media Integration: Social media platforms are playing an increasingly important role in cross-platform entertainment, with companies leveraging these channels to engage with audiences in new and innovative ways. From live streaming events to interactive storytelling campaigns, social media is reshaping how content is consumed and shared. By integrating social media into their strategies, entertainment companies can reach a wider audience and create more meaningful connections with their fans.
5. Data Analytics and Personalization: Data analytics and personalization are enabling entertainment companies to better understand their audiences and tailor content to their preferences. By analyzing user behavior and engagement metrics, companies can create personalized recommendations, targeted advertising, and interactive experiences that resonate with viewers. This data-driven approach not only enhances the viewer experience but also improves operational efficiency by optimizing content production and distribution strategies.
